Baton Rouge’s Catholic High scored on its first four possessions on the way to an easy 55-31 win over Acadiana for the Prep Classic Select Division I championship Friday night at the Caesars Superdome, home of the New Orleans Saints. Bears QB Beale finished the night 19-for-26 for 360 yards with four touchdowns.

Both teams entered the game ranked in the High School Football America 300 national rankings, powered by NFL Play FootballCatholic was No. 92, Acadiana was No. 171.
